The film
Born on the occasion of the exhibition curated by Beatrice Avanzi and Tiziano Panconi, that the Mart of Rovereto dedicated to the well-known Ferrara painter to celebrate the ninetieth anniversary of his death, the film traces the salient and iconic moments of the extraordinary life of Giovanni Boldini (Ferrara 1842 – Paris 1931) between Florence, Venice (where he was a member of the sponsoring committee of the first Art Biennale), London, New York, Paris but also Montecarlo, the French Riviera and Sankt Moritz, where he used to go on holiday.
The articulated screenplay of the film intertwines various levels of the narrative to draw a lively and faithful portrait of the artist, combining unpublished images from private archives with footage from the exhibition set up at the Mart, footage of the time with recreated scenes created to relive the sophisticated atmosphere and the elegant style of the time, also thanks to the narrative voices of the actors of cinema and theater Alessia Patregnani and Francesco Mastrorilli.
The documentary includes speeches by Vittorio Sgarbi, art historian and President of the Mart, the curators Beatrice Avanzi and Tiziano Panconi, Annalisa Casagranda (Education and cultural mediation area of the Mart), and, as guest star, Cecilia Matteucci Lavarini, collector and icon of Alta Moda, who recently took part in a video advertising for Roger Vivier together with Chaterine Deneuve.
The artist
Giovanni Boldini attended many intellectuals of the time including Gabriele D’Annunzio, Filippo Tommaso Marinetti, Giuseppe Verdi and again Edgar Degas (with whom he visits Spain and Morocco), Edouard Manet, Alfred Sisley, John Sargent, Marcel Proust.
In 1871 he settled permanently in Paris, precisely during the Belle Époque, the most fascinating period of European culture between the nineteenth and twentieth centuries. Halfway between the most sumptuous luxury and the eccentric and smug elegance of the Dandies, Boldini was the most famous Italian artist in the world, giving rise to a real Boldini mania: princesses, countesses, actresses and wealthy international travelers came to Paris from all over Europe and America just to be portrayed by him.
Before starting to work on his paintings, Boldini used to make sure that his illustrious models wore an outfit that matched his impeccable taste, personally accompanying them from Cartier and Boucheron for the purchase of sumptuous jewels and accessories and in couturier ateliers such as Paul Poiret, Charles Frederick Worth, Jeanne Lanvin and Jacques Doucet.
